*) Four Turkish soldiers killed in Syria

We begin in Syria where regime shelling killed least four Turkish soldiers and wounded nine others in northern Idlib province.

The shelling took place despite Turkish positions being shared with the regime beforehand, the Turkish defence ministry said.

Meanwhile, regime air strikes killed at least 14 civilians on Sunday in Idlib province’s Sarmin and in Aleppo’s Atareb cities.

*) Coronavirus death toll jumps

The death toll from the novel coronavirus has jumped to at least 361 in China and the total number of people affected in China to 17,205.

There are now at least 157 cases reported in at least two dozen countries outside China.

A hospital dedicated to treating patients with the coronavirus is set to open in Wuhan today after ten days of construction.

*) Iraq protest death toll rises to 556

Anti-government protesters have rejected the nomination of Mohammad Allawi as caretaker prime minister.

Protesters slammed the former communication director’s appointment, saying Allawi is part of the system they want reformed.

Meanwhile, the death toll from violence against protesters since October has risen to 556, Iraq's Independent High Commission for Human Rights said.

*) Somalia declares locust emergency

Somalia has declared a national emergency over a locust infestation across the Horn of Africa.

The insects have been devastating food supplies in one of the poorest and most vulnerable regions in the world.

The declaration was made to focus efforts and raise funds to contain the swarms before harvests in April.

*) Mendes wins big but BAFTA lacks diversity

Sam Mendes’ World War One film “1917” has dominated the British Film and Television Awards in London.

Renee Zelwegger won Best Actress for her titular role in biopic “Judy” and Joaquin Phoenix picked up Best Actor for his role in “Joker”.

There was some dismay at the lack of racial diversity among the acting nominations, as well as the all-male line up for Best Director.
